First-year program (one-time + first-year recurring) is approximately $4.98M driven primarily by bespoke engineering (observation window and facility modifications), bespoke sensor/DAQ systems and data infrastructure, insurance/contingency reserves, and incremental security staffing. Ongoing annual costs are ~ $1.25M dominated by dedicated security wages and research/monitoring support.

Cost Scenarios
📊 Baseline (baseline) $1.2M/yr
93.0% probability / year
Normal uneventful year with no major incidents; routine monitoring, maintenance, training and staffing costs only.
no accidental closure no major loss of equipment standard operations only
🚨 Minor Incident $1.5M/yr
6.0% probability / year +$300K vs baseline
Localized accidental closure or limited exposure, requiring emergency response, limited investigation, data reconstruction, and modest PR/legal action.
accidental door closure limited personnel exposure loss of expendable sensors/data segments
🚨 Major Breach $2.7M/yr
1.0% probability / year +$1.5M vs baseline
Significant procedural failure leading to multiple personnel exposures, large legal/settlement costs, possible decommissioning expenses and heavy use of contingency/insurance reserves.
multiple personnel lost/exposed large-scale procedural failure external awareness or legal action
